Hosting a Virtual Write-In
Literary Mama did last week and we had a great time! Thank you to everyone who attended. Lots of words were generated during the hour that flew by. If you plan to host your own virtual write-in, here are a few tips:
Provide an optional prompt, like the March writing prompts.
Ask everyone to keep their video on and mics muted.
Set a timer because time will fly.
Have fun!
